랄라

[TIL 12일차] 25.02.27 본문

내일배움캠프/TIL

[TIL 12일차] 25.02.27

devdaeun 2025. 2. 27. 11:41

프로젝트가 완료되어서 이제 다시 마무리되지않았던 docker 강의를 다시들어보려고한다.


오전에 진행한 코드카타.

LV1 푸드파이트 대회 https://school.programmers.co.kr/learn/courses/30/lessons/134240

 

프로그래머스

SW개발자를 위한 평가, 교육, 채용까지 Total Solution을 제공하는 개발자 성장을 위한 베이스캠프

programmers.co.kr

 

class Solution {
    public String solution(int[] food) {
        String answer = "";
        //food[0] = 물 , 나머지는 1번 2번 3번 음식의 양
        StringBuilder sb = new StringBuilder();
        for(int i=1; i<food.length; i++){
            int number = food[i] / 2; //1
            for(int j=1; j<=number; j++){
                sb.append(i);
            }
        }
        sb.append("0");
        for(int i=food.length-1; i>=1; i--){
            int number = food[i] / 2; //1
            for(int j=1; j<=number; j++){
                sb.append(i);
            }
        }
        
        
        answer = sb.toString();
        
        return answer;
    }
}

 

 


Docker 5주차 요약정리

 

volume

데이터 영속성을위해 사용되는 기능, 공식사이트에서도 추천.

컴퓨터에서 따로 만들어지는 폴더, 어디에서나 잘 작동하는 장점을 가지고있다.

 

bind mount

docker 내부에 존재하는 file system의 특정공간에 데이터를 보관

파일을 붙여넣는것과 비슷하다고 할 수 있다. 특정 데이터를 다뤄야할때 도움이된다.

 

tmpfs mount

데이터를 일시적으로 저장하는 방법, 잠깐 필요한 데이터를 다룰때 사용된다.

컨테이너가 종료되는경우 자동으로 데이터도 사라진다.

'내일배움캠프 > TIL' 카테고리의 다른 글

[TIL 14일차]25.03.05  (0) 2025.03.05
[TIL 13일차]25.03.04  (0) 2025.03.04
[TIL 11일차] 25.02.26  (0) 2025.02.27
[TIL 10일차] 25.02.25  (0) 2025.02.24
[TIL 9일차] 25.02.21  (0) 2025.02.21